The July 4th weekend has become “Class
Reunion” weekend in Ely, Nevada. Graduates from White Pine High
School return to their hometown from their new homes all over
the world. It’s a time to see old friends, visit family and take
a trip down memory lane.
Some things haven’t changed much since we graduated... the
mountains and skies are still beautiful, there are still only
three stop lights and no traffic jams and no Wal-Marts, you can
still see wildlife and wildflowers all over the hills.
But there are also many new things to see and do in the county.
Come check out the new internationally famous murals on
buildings all over Ely, have a milkshake at Economy Drug’s new
50's style fountain (yes they still serve the best tuna
sandwiches), see the new facilities at Cave Lake and the
Charcoal Ovens, or drive out to the Great Basin National Park
and hike up to see the Bristlecone Pines (still among the
worlds’ oldest living things!).
